Famen Temple (法门寺), located in Fufeng County about 120 kilometers west of Xi'an, is one of the most revered Buddhist sites in China. Founded in the 3rd century AD during the Eastern Han Dynasty, this ancient temple holds what is believed to be the left ring finger bone of Buddha Sakyamuni - the only authenticated relic of the Buddha in the world.
For over 1,700 years, emperors of various dynasties have made pilgrimages to Famen Temple to pay homage to this sacred relic. The temple's significance reached its peak when Empress Wu Zetian, China's only female emperor, declared herself the reincarnation of Maitreya Buddha and supported the temple's expansion. The current magnificent pagoda was built to house the precious relic in 1987 after its rediscovery in the underground palace.
Beyond its spiritual significance, Famen Temple houses one of China's finest collections of Buddhist artifacts, including Tang Dynasty gold and silver relics, Buddhist scriptures, and ancient ceramics. The temple complex features beautiful gardens and traditional architecture that provide a serene environment for contemplation and exploration.

Take a high-speed train from Xi'an North Station to Yangling South Station (30-40 minutes, 30-40 CNY). Then take a taxi to Famen Temple (35 minutes, 80-100 CNY).
Tour buses depart from the West Gate of Tang Paradise Scenic Area around 8:00 AM, returning around 4:00 PM. Cost: 25 CNY one-way.
Buses depart from Xi'an Chengxi Bus Station to Fufeng, then transfer to local bus to Famen Town. Total journey: 2-3 hours.
